How Our Residential Water Removal Process Works

We understand that every water damage situation is unique, which is why our team takes a customized approach to every job. From assessing the damage to completing the restoration, we’ll guide you through the process every step of the way.

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Our technicians will arrive quickly to assess the damage and find out the best course of action.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and identify areas of concern.

Step 2: Containment and Drying

We’ll set up containment systems to prevent further damage and drying equipment to remove excess moisture from the air and surfaces.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and further damage.

Step 3: Water Extraction and Cleanup

Our team will extract standing water using specialized equipment, and then thoroughly clean and disinfect the affected areas to prevent bacterial growth.

Step 4: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use industrial-strength fans to speed up the drying process and remove any remaining moisture from the air and surfaces.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is safe and dry.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ration

Our technicians will conduct a final inspection to ensure all affected areas are dry and free of moisture. We’ll then work with you to restore your home to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Residential Water Removal

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these warning signs – call us today to schedule your Residential Water Removal service.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ors can be a sign of moisture buildup and potential mold growth. If you notice a musty smell in your home, it’s time to call us.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this in your home, it’s essential to act quickly to prevent further damage.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a larger issue. If you notice water stains on your ceilings or walls, don’t delay – call us today.

Discoloration or Warping of Wood

Discoloration or warping of wood can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this in your home, it’s time to call us.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this in your home, don’t delay – call us today.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this in your home, it’s essential to act quickly to prevent further damage.

Residential Water Removal Cost in Deep Creek, FL

The cost of Residential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here’s a general estimate of what you might expect to pay: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Inspection and Assessment $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Water Extraction and Cleanup $500 – $2,500 Amount of water, type of materials affected
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Final Inspection and Restoration $100 – $500 Severity of damage, type of materials affected
Total Cost $800 – $4,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, type of materials affected
